A vulnerability has been found in Linux Kernel up to 6.12.61/6.17.11 and classified as critical. This vulnerability affects an unknown code of the component bfs. The manipulation with an unknown input leads to a initialization vulnerability. The CWE definition for the vulnerability is CWE-665. The product does not initialize or incorrectly initializes a resource, which might leave the resource in an unexpected state when it is accessed or used. The impact remains unknown. CVE summarizes:

In the Linux kernel, the following vulnerability has been resolved: bfs: Reconstruct file type when loading from disk syzbot is reporting that S_IFMT bits of inode->i_mode can become bogus when the S_IFMT bits of the 32bits "mode" field loaded from disk are corrupted or when the 32bits "attributes" field loaded from disk are corrupted. A documentation says that BFS uses only lower 9 bits of the "mode" field. But I can't find an explicit explanation that the unused upper 23 bits (especially, the S_IFMT bits) are initialized with 0. Therefore, ignore the S_IFMT bits of the "mode" field loaded from disk. Also, verify that the value of the "attributes" field loaded from disk is either BFS_VREG or BFS_VDIR (because BFS supports only regular files and the root directory).

The advisory is available at git.kernel.org. This vulnerability was named CVE-2025-68266 since 12/16/2025. The technical details are unknown and an exploit is not available. The structure of the vulnerability defines a possible price range of USD $0-$5k at the moment (estimation calculated on 02/22/2026).

The vulnerability scanner Nessus provides a plugin with the ID 298404 (Debian dsa-6127 : affs-modules-6.1.0-37-4kc-malta-di - security update), which helps to determine the existence of the flaw in a target environment.

Upgrading to version 6.12.62 or 6.17.12 eliminates this vulnerability. Applying the patch 77899444d46162aeb65f229590c26ba266864223/a8cb796e7e2cb7971311ba236922f5e7e1be77e6/34ab4c75588c07cca12884f2bf6b0347c7a13872 is able to eliminate this problem. The bugfix is ready for download at git.kernel.org. The best possible mitigation is suggested to be upgrading to the latest version.
